O Ubuntu trava ao definir a resolução máxima no monitor 4K externo

9

Problema

Ao tentar definir a resolução do meu monitor externo 4K para 3840x2160, o monitor externo perde o sinal e, momentos depois, o sistema inteiro trava.

O monitor está conectado ao meu XPS 13 9350 Developer Edition executando o Ubuntu 16.04 usando um adaptador USB-C para DisplayPort.

Hardware:

Tentativas de correção

Definindo a resolução manualmente

Tentei usar xrandrpara definir manualmente o modo e a taxa de atualização da tela. Configurá-lo para 4K a 60Hz mostra os mesmos problemas que configurá-lo na GUI, mas se eu configurá-lo para 4K em 30Hz, ele funciona bem .

Não funciona: xrandr --output DP1 --mode 3840x2160 -r 60.00
Funciona:xrandr --output DP1 --mode 3840x2160 -r 29.98

Vários adaptadores

Tentei usar vários adaptadores USB-C para DisplayPort diferentes, os quais dão a impressão de que são capazes de resolução de 4K a 60Hz. O adaptador usado não parece fazer diferença no problema.

Atualização do Kernel

Atualizei o kernel para a versão 4.6, caso um suporte melhor fosse adicionado aos gráficos integrados da Iris. Parece que isso não fez nenhuma diferença.

Espero que as etapas que foram tomadas, documentadas acima, ajudem a diagnosticar o problema.

andy1633
fonte
A porta usb c é o link mais fraco aqui, eu tenho uma configuração quase idêntica no meu m3800, mas a porta do monitor está acima do raio e funciona bem. Uma coisa a verificar é se o monitor está no modo da porta 1.2 ou superior. Você também pode tentar reduzir a atualização em 1hz para 59khz para facilitar o processo no computador. Você pode gerar modelos com CVT e aplicá-los com xrandr. Existem mensagens de erro específicas?
Amias
O monitor está definido no modo DisplayPort 1.2, de acordo com as instruções no manual. A única mensagem de erro real que eu vi é um erro dizendo que não foi possível carregar o arquivo de configuração da tela após uma reinicialização. Vou dar uma olhada no ajuste da taxa de atualização, como você sugeriu.
precisa saber é
Eu já vi esse erro antes, é porque o monitor não respondeu rápido o suficiente, leva alguns segundos para sincronizar um monitor 4k.
Amias
esta discussão tem muitas sugestões ubuntuforums.org/showthread.php?t=2301071&page=35
Amias
Posso confirmar exatamente o mesmo problema com o Lenovo Yoga 900 usando os adaptadores USB-C para HDMI e DisplayPort. O visor está em branco a 60Hz, embora o xrandr relate que o modo está disponível. Reduzir um pouco a frequência também não funciona - mas descer para 30Hz funciona - no entanto, a latência é horrível. Eu eliminei meu hardware como o problema, pois a inicialização no Windows 10 com os mesmos adaptadores / tela me proporciona uma sólida 3840x2160 a 60Hz através de USB-C para HDMI e DisplayPort.
Drplix

Respostas:

4

Tendo o mesmo problema com o XPS 9350 (QHD +, BIOS v1.4.4) e o monitor externo Dell P2415Q. Estou usando o cabo adaptador USB-C para adaptador DisplayPort .

A atualização do kernel para a v4.8-rc2 parece resolver esse problema. Estou escrevendo este post no monitor externo rodando em 3840x2160 60Hz.

Dito isto, é bastante instável. Ele trava com freqüência ao conectar / desconectar o adaptador e existem alguns artefatos gráficos que aparecem ao mover o mouse e as janelas.

Minha esperança é que a versão final do kernel resolva esses problemas ou, pelo menos, o kernel 4.9.

ATUALIZAÇÃO: O Ubuntu (Gnome) 16.10 funciona muito bem para a configuração acima. Até o momento, não há problemas, exceto alguns monitores piscando de tempos em tempos.

aramboi
fonte
11
Parece que a Intel forneceu alguns drivers atualizados no kernel 4.8. Phoronix.com/…
andy1633
De acordo com este news.slashdot.org/story/16/06/09/1433229/… , o Ubuntu 16.10 será lançado com o kernel 4.8, então esperamos que todos esses problemas desapareçam em outubro.
Aramboi
Eu tenho exatamente o mesmo hardware que você (exceto o monitor - o meu é um P2715Q). Com o kernel 4.4, o Ubuntu 16.04 apenas travou ao conectar o adaptador USBC ao DP. Atualizei para o kernel 4.7 e o adaptador pode ser usado até 2560x1440 a 60Hz, mas ainda trava com 4k.
Leo Brito
O @brito no momento parece que apenas o kernel 4.8 resolverá esses problemas. Estou usando o 4.8-rc7 agora e parece bastante estável. Se você não deseja atualizar seu kernel para um RC, pode esperar um mês até o lançamento do Ubuntu 16.10, que viria com esta versão (esperando que ele esteja estável até então).
Aramboi 19/09/16
11
@brito Eu tenho a edição de desenvolvedor do XPS que vem com o chip intel wifi, e não o da broadcom. Para mim, ele funciona bem com o kernel 4.8 estável (eu tenho problemas com a conexão com fio).
Aramboi # 5/16